Ciliary Muscle
A ring-shaped muscle in the eye's middle layer (uvea) that controls the lens's shape for focusing and accommodation.
Lateral Line Organs
Specialized sensory organs in fish and amphibians, consisting of a system of fluid-filled canals and sensory hair cells to detect movement and vibration in the surrounding water.
Stereocilia
Hairlike projections on the surface of certain cells, such as those in the inner ear, involved in mechanosensation and the detection of sound vibrations.
Hair Cells
Sensory cells located in the inner ear that detect sound and head movements.
